Abstract

The utility model discloses a high-efficiency cleaning dust remover which comprises a dust removing cleaning head, a protective cover and a dust collection box, wherein the dust removing cleaning head is arranged in the protective cover in a lifting manner, a rotary spray head is arranged in the dust removing cleaning head, two groups of high-pressure ion air bars are arranged in the dust removing cleaning head, an air suction groove is arranged in the dust removing cleaning head, the upper end of the protective cover is communicated with a dust collection cover, one end of a first corrugated hose is positioned in the dust collection cover, the upper end of the dust collection cover is communicated with a second corrugated hose, and one end of the second corrugated hose is communicated with the top of the dust collection box. When the dust removal device is used, the high-voltage ion wind rod is arranged, so that the adsorption force of electrostatic dust can be reduced, the rotary spray head is arranged, dust hidden in a gap or under an electrical element can be blown out, the dust is rolled up through rotation, and then the dust is removed, so that the dust can be completely removed, and the dust removal device is very convenient to use.

Background
In the prior art, the cleaning machines are all used for directly aiming at the cleaned object to clean by connecting a dust suction head with a blower and directly aiming at the cleaned object to clean like a common dust collector, and the cleaning mode is mainly aimed at dust or dust without sticky particles.
However, when the dust with static electricity is attached to the object to be cleaned, the dust is difficult to be sucked only by vacuum suction due to the large adsorption force, and the surface of some of the object to be cleaned is uneven, such as a circuit board with component elements inserted therein, various component elements are densely assembled together, when the object to be cleaned is pulled up from flowing water and passes through the dust collection head, part of the components block the air suction, the dust or various slag hidden in gaps or under the electrical components is not sucked, and is difficult to be cleaned, which directly affects the quality problem of the product, and the use is very inconvenient, so that a high-efficiency dust collector needs to be provided.

Compared with the prior art, the utility model has the beneficial effects that:
compared with the traditional dust removal cleaning head, the dust removal cleaning head is additionally provided with the high-voltage ion air bar and the rotary spray head, when a product with high electrostatic dust adsorption force passes through the lower part of the dust removal cleaning head, the high-voltage ion air bar discharges positive and negative ions to neutralize the static electricity on the surface of the product, after the static electricity of the product is eliminated, the dust adsorption force is greatly reduced, gas on the rotary spray head is forcefully discharged from the fine holes, the dust removal hidden in components is blown out, the dust is rolled up through rotation, the airflow is like tornado to roll up the dust, and then the rolled-up dust is easily sucked away by using the high-voltage air blower, so that the dust on the cleaned object is conveniently removed, and the dust removal cleaning head is very convenient to use.

When the utility model is used, firstly the dust-removing cleaning head 1 is placed at a designated position, then the product can easily pass through the lower part of the dust-removing cleaning head 1, when the product passes through the dust-removing cleaning head 1, firstly the high-pressure ion air bar 102 is used for discharging positive and negative ions so as to neutralize the static electricity carried on the surface of the product, when the static electricity of the product is eliminated, the dust adsorption force is greatly reduced, the gas flowing at high speed can be sprayed out from the rotary spray head 101 through the quick air inlet joint 103, two fine air outlet holes are arranged at two ends of the rotary spray head 101, the air outlet holes form a certain angle with the horizontal direction, when the rotary spray head 101 is ventilated and rotates at high speed, the discharged gas rhythmically beats on the surface of the cleaned object to form a similar tornado airflow shape, the granular substances on the surface of the cleaned object are rolled up, the air extraction grooves 106 are arranged at two sides of the rotary spray head 101, the rotated granular objects are sucked by the high-pressure blower 9 and pass through the air extraction groove 106, then enters the second corrugated hose 7, is filtered by a filtering component 8 (a high-efficiency filter screen and high-efficiency filter cotton), enters the high-pressure air blower 9, is discharged into the dust collection box 10, the high-efficiency filter cotton is arranged at the air outlet 14 of the dust collection box 10, and is used for filtering gas to be discharged, and finally, the gas sucked by the high-pressure air blower 9 is discharged from the air outlet 14.
